083363833fa7cfc96100ee0d6c7aeed81e4f3b2ff4989377846c3715bac3c4f5

2041371 (387 blocks ago)

429712567

⏴ Block 2041370 (342b60a3...4b7) | Block 2041372 ⏵ | Latest block ⏭

Metadata

7/2/26, 9:44 pm UTC (12:55:07 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 32.3297 SENT

Transactions (0)

Show raw details